AN ACT
|
|
relating to food handlers and other food service employees. |
|
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: |
|
SECTION 1. Chapter 437, Health and Safety Code, is amended |
|
by adding Section 437.0057 to read as follows: |
|
Sec. 437.0057. REGULATION OF FOOD HANDLERS AND OTHER FOOD |
|
SERVICE EMPLOYEES BY COUNTIES, PUBLIC HEALTH DISTRICTS, AND THE |
|
DEPARTMENT. (a) A county, a public health district, or the |
|
department may require certification under Subchapter D, Chapter |
|
438, for each food handler who is employed by a food service |
|
establishment in which food is prepared on-site for sale to the |
|
public and which holds a permit issued by the county, the public |
|
health district, or the department. This section applies without |
|
regard to whether the food service establishment is at a fixed |
|
location or is a mobile food unit. |
|
(b) The requirements of certification under this section |
|
may not be more stringent than the requirements of Subchapter D, |
|
Chapter 438. |
|
(c) A county, a public health district, or the department |
|
may not require an establishment that handles only prepackaged food |
|
and does not prepare or package food to employ certified food |
|
handlers under this section. |
|
(d) A county, a public health district, or the department |
|
may exempt a food service establishment from the requirement that |
|
the county, public health district, or department has imposed under |
|
Subsection (a) if the county, the public health district, or the |
|
department determines that the application of Subsection (a) to |
|
that establishment is not necessary to protect public health and |
|
safety. |
|
(e) A county, a public health district, or the department |
|
may require a food service establishment to: |
|
(1) post a sign in a place conspicuous to employees, in |
|
a form adopted by the executive commissioner of the Health and Human |
|
Services Commission, describing a food service employee's |
|
responsibilities to report certain health conditions to the permit |
|
holder under rules adopted by the executive commissioner; or |
|
(2) require that each food service employee sign a |
|
written agreement in a form adopted by the executive commissioner |
|
to report those health conditions. |

SECTION 2. Section 438.034, Health and Safety Code, is |
|
amended to read as follows: |
|
Sec. 438.034. EMPLOYEE CLEANLINESS. (a) A person |
|
handling food or unsealed food containers shall: |
|
(1) maintain personal cleanliness; |
|
(2) wear clean outer garments; |
|
(3) keep the person's hands clean; and |
|
(4) [either:
|
|
[(A)] wash the person's hands and exposed |
|
portions of the person's arms with soap and water: |
|
(A) before starting work; |
|
(B) [,] during work as often as necessary to |
|
avoid cross-contaminating food; and |
|
(C) to maintain cleanliness, after smoking, |
|
eating, and each visit to the toilet[; or
|
|
[(B)
avoid bare-hand contact with exposed food by
|
|
the use of gloves or utensils and wash hands after smoking, eating,
|
|
and each visit to the toilet]. |
|
(b) A person handling food or unsealed food containers may |
|
not contact with bare hands exposed ready-to-eat food unless: |
|
(1) documentation is maintained at the food service |
|
establishment listing the foods and food handling activities that |
|
involve bare-hand contact; and |
|
(2) the food service establishment uses two or more of |
|
the following contamination control measures: |
|
(A) requiring employees to perform double hand |
|
washing; |
|
(B) requiring employees to use fingernail |
|
brushes while hand washing; |
|
(C) requiring employees to use a hand sanitizer |
|
after hand washing; |
|
(D) implementing an incentive program that |
|
encourages employees not to come to work when ill; and |
|
(E) any other contamination control measure |
|
approved by the regulatory authority. |

SECTION 3. (a) Not later than December 1, 2009, the |
|
executive commissioner of the Health and Human Services Commission |
|
shall adopt the form of the sign and the form of the employee |
|
agreement under Section 437.0057(e), Health and Safety Code, as |
|
added by this Act. |
|
(b) A county, a public health district, or the Department of |
|
State Health Services may not require a food service establishment |
|
to post the sign or have the food service employees sign an |
|
agreement under Section 437.0057(e), Health and Safety Code, as |
|
added by this Act, before January 1, 2010. |
|
SECTION 4. This Act takes effect September 1, 2009. |
